-- tolua: abstract feature class
-- Written by Waldemar Celes
-- TeCGraf/PUC-Rio
-- Jul 1998
-- $Id: feature.lua,v 1.1 2009-07-09 13:44:43 fabraham Exp $
-- This code is free software; you can redistribute it and/or modify it.
-- The software provided hereunder is on an "as is" basis, and
-- the author has no obligation to provide maintenance, support, updates,
-- enhancements, or modifications.
-- Feature class
-- Represents the base class of all mapped feature.
classFeature = {
}
classFeature.__index = classFeature
-- write support code
function classFeature:supcode ()
end
-- output tag
function classFeature:decltype ()
end
-- register feature
function classFeature:register ()
end
-- translate verbatim
function classFeature:preamble ()
end
-- check if it is a variable
function classFeature:isvariable ()
return false
end
-- checi if it requires collection
function classFeature:requirecollection (t)
return false
end
-- build names
function classFeature:buildnames ()
if self.name and self.name~='' then
local n = split(self.name,'@')
self.name = n[1]
if not n[2] then
n[2] = applyrenaming(n[1])
end
self.lname = n[2] or gsub(n[1],"%[.-%]","")
end
self.name = getonlynamespace() .. self.name
end
-- check if feature is inside a container definition
-- it returns the container class name or nil.
function classFeature:incontainer (which)
if self.parent then
local parent = self.parent
while parent do
if parent.classtype == which then
return parent.name
end
parent = parent.parent
end
end
return nil
end
function classFeature:inclass ()
return self:incontainer('class')
end
function classFeature:inmodule ()
return self:incontainer('module')
end
function classFeature:innamespace ()
return self:incontainer('namespace')
end
-- return C binding function name based on name
-- the client specifies a prefix
function classFeature:cfuncname (n)
if self.parent then
n = self.parent:cfuncname(n)
end
if self.lname and
strsub(self.lname,1,1)~="." -- operator are named as ".add"
then
return n..'_'..self.lname
else
return n..'_'..self.name
end
end
